For a Lexus IS 250, spark plugs should typically be changed every 60,000 to 100,000 miles, depending on the type of spark plugs used and driving conditions. It's best to consult the owner's manual for specific recommendations for your vehicle. Regular maintenance and inspections can help determine if earlier replacement is needed.
